Product Description
This Accortec transceiver module operates at a 1310nm wavelength, making it suitable for standard optical communication over single-mode fiber (SMF). It utilizes the SFP (Small Form-factor Pluggable) form factor, which is a compact, hot-pluggable module designed for a wide range of networking equipment, including switches, routers, and network interface cards that support SFP ports. The 7SU-000-ACC is engineered for single-mode fiber, enabling data transmission over distances typically up to 10 kilometers. This makes it an effective solution for connecting network segments within a building, across a campus, or for metropolitan area network (MAN) deployments where longer reach is required compared to multi-mode fiber. The LC duplex connector ensures a secure and standard physical connection for the fiber optic cables. Adhering to industry standards such as SFF-8472, this transceiver provides reliable performance and interoperability. It is commonly used for Gigabit Ethernet (1GbE) and Fibre Channel applications requiring a balance of speed and distance. The 1310nm wavelength is a common choice for single-mode transceivers due to its performance characteristics over longer fiber runs.
